local ROOT = (...):gsub('[^.]*.[^.]*$', '')
local Hooker = require(ROOT .. 'hooker')
local ffi = require 'ffi'
local sdl = require((...) .. '.sdl')
local Image = require((...) .. '.image')
local Font = require((...) .. '.font')
local Keyboard = require((...) .. '.keyboard')
local Text = require((...) .. '.text')
local IntOut = ffi.typeof 'int[1]'
-- create window and renderer
sdl.setHint(sdl.HINT_VIDEO_ALLOW_SCREENSAVER, '1')
local window = sdl.createWindow('', 0, 0, 800, 600,
sdl.WINDOW_SHOWN + sdl.WINDOW_RESIZABLE)
if window == nil then
error(ffi.string(sdl.getError()))
end
ffi.gc(window, sdl.destroyWindow)
local renderer = sdl.createRenderer(window, -1,
sdl.RENDERER_ACCELERATED + sdl.RENDERER_PRESENTVSYNC)
if renderer == nil then
error(ffi.string(sdl.getError()))
end
ffi.gc(renderer, sdl.destroyRenderer)
local Backend = {}
Backend.sdl = sdl
local callback = {
draw = function () end,
resize = function () end,
mousepressed = function () end,
mousereleased = function () end,
mousemoved = function () end,
keypressed = function () end,
keyreleased = function () end,
textinput = function () end,
wheelmoved = function () end,
}
Backend.run = function ()
local event = sdl.Event()
while true do
sdl.pumpEvents()
while sdl.pollEvent(event) ~= 0 do
if event.type == sdl.QUIT then
return
elseif event.type == sdl.WINDOWEVENT
and event.window.event == sdl.WINDOWEVENT_RESIZED then
local window = event.window
callback.resize(window.data1, window.data2)
elseif event.type == sdl.MOUSEBUTTONDOWN then
local button = event.button
callback.mousepressed(button.x, button.y, button.button)
elseif event.type == sdl.MOUSEBUTTONUP then
local button = event.button
callback.mousereleased(button.x, button.y, button.button)
elseif event.type == sdl.MOUSEMOTION then
local motion = event.motion
callback.mousemoved(motion.x, motion.y)
elseif event.type == sdl.KEYDOWN then
local key = Keyboard.stringByKeycode[event.key.keysym.sym]
callback.keypressed(key, event.key['repeat'])
elseif event.type == sdl.KEYUP then
local key = Keyboard.stringByKeycode[event.key.keysym.sym]
callback.keyreleased(key, event.key['repeat'])
elseif event.type == sdl.TEXTINPUT then
callback.textinput(ffi.string(event.text.text))
elseif event.type == sdl.MOUSEWHEEL then
local wheel = event.wheel
callback.wheelmoved(wheel.x, wheel.y)
end
end
sdl.renderSetClipRect(renderer, nil)
sdl.setRenderDrawColor(renderer, 0, 0, 0, 255)
sdl.renderClear(renderer)
callback.draw()
sdl.renderPresent(renderer)
sdl.delay(1)
end
end
